Traumatic vulva hematoma in children: Mechanism and management

Traumatic vulvar hematomas are rare in children. they are most often due to perineal blunt trauma in non obstetric population. 520 |a Traumatic vulvar hematomas are rare in children. they are most often due to perineal blunt trauma in non obstetric population. Management was not establishing and conservative treatment alone is sufficient in most cases. The time to surgery and their indications must be precise to avoid complication. This is a report of a teenager who presented with a large right vulva hematoma after pubic blunt trauma. Surgical intervention was done faced to the failure of initial conservative treatment. The outcome was uneventfull.
